As a professional event and corporate photographer operating in Scotland, I have undertaken many commissions which involved photographing cars, from supercar events, to vintage cars and scrapyard and general car photos as part of my infrared in Scotland project.  I thought this would be a good time to give you some tips on photographing cars.  To keep it simple I will concentrate on outdoor photos without any flash or artificial light and I promise not to get too technical.  So here we go:

1. Its all about the weather, stormy skies, or sunny days with with blue skies and cloud are ideal, especially for infrared photography

2. Dont be frightened to get in close when shooting a stationary vehicle

3. Keep an eye out for interesting close up detail, especially for vintage and scrap cars

4. Its not always the supercars that are best to photograph, scrap cars and old wrecks often have bags of character

5. Vary your angle, get down low if possible and include interesting backdrops ie trees, sky etc, otherwise, avoid clutter in the backround

6. Use a tripod if you want good depth of field

7. Cars are a great way to showcase other genres such as architecture, weddings, urban photography etc

8. Use people in the photo if relevant ie a driver or someone behind the story of the car

9. Shoot through the window, sometimes the interior of the cars can be interesting

10. If shooting moving vehicles, change your angle, get down low and high and pan your photos now and again to get some motion blur
